Clouds Of Witness - Dorothy L. Sayers

 
Description: ISBN 0450001806 / Author: Dorothy L. Sayers / Genre: Crime / Thriller / The Duke of Denver stands accused of the murder of his sister's fiance. The Duke's brother, Lord Peter Wimsey attempts to prove his innocence, but why is the Duke refusing to co-operate? Is he protecting ... more
Clouds Of Witness - Dorothy L. Sayers ... someone? Trying to uncover the truth, Wimsey himself becomes a target.
